You certainly can go with the manufacturer's suggestions, but don't sweat all the supplements. Use them if you like, but I have never found them necessary. Some folks would even say that they are purely developed for profit margin.

For flowering, I work up to 2tsp Grow Big, 1tsp Tigerbloom and 1Tbs Big Bloom throughout the whole cycle-- I also add 1tsp of Cal-Mag because I run in a soiless medium. With any nutrient regimen, you will have to adjust based on what the plants are telling you. It's all NPK, so if they need more P add a bit more Tigerbloom, if they need N, add a bit more Grow Big, etc.
